    Well, I managed to get this UFO done today! But the funny thing was...

    While I was watching TV and finishing the binding on this quilt, someone came to the door and asked if she could buy a quilt. So I sold another quilt today! She was one of the people I talked with during the Garage Sale about quilting. She did not buy anything that day, but she blew me away today!

    This quilt is called "Holiday Cheer", designed by Gudrun Erla, and on the cover of F&P Love of Quilting Magazine from Nov/Dec 2009. And I probably started in 2009....but it's done now! The magazine called for tons of quilting, but I chose not to make it as stiff as cardboard...it's mostly outlined and is soft and cuddly.

    Thanks for looking.
